Simulation and experimental research on ultrasonic vibration

202251  Ultrasonic vibration rock crushing technology is a new type of rock crushing method, and it can be used in hard rock drilling. By applying high-frequency cyclic load to the rock, it promotes the expansion and penetration of micro-cracks inside the rock, causing fatigue damage, reducing the rock strength, and thus improving the rock crushing
